ADDISON v. STATE

No. 2006-CP-00299-COA.

957 So.2d 1039 (2007)

Ronald ADDISON, Appellant v. STATE of Mississippi, Appellee.

Court of Appeals of Mississippi.

May 22, 2007.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Ronald Addison, Appellant, pro se.

Office Of The Attorney General By Scott Stuart, Attorney for Appellee.

Before LEE, P.J., BARNES and CARLTON, JJ.


BARNES, J., for the Court.

¶ 1. Ronald Addison pled guilty to two counts of possession of a controlled substance and one count of manufacture of a controlled substance. Sentenced to three consecutive ten year sentences, Addison sought to set the sentences aside. He appeals from the circuit court's denial of his motion to vacate or set aside the sentences.
